Year established (YYYY): 2006
Year of registration (YYYY): 2010
Organizational structure: At the top is the Assembly, then the Board. then the Executive Director who is assisted by three Directors- Operations, finance and Production. The Directors head Departments
Number and type of members: We have 750 members all women who aresubscriber members with equal rights to vote and be voted for on Board of Directors.
Affiliation with NGO networks: Women Reproductive Health
